Output 3cdb30203670b91d111d66a752a43aa771c50dfe976fed1d035af07728f76416:1

value
9445490
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98b477560c4a9a9ba83d1e8c6dde4e07a9c1713e OP_EQUALVERIFY OP_CHECKSIG
address
1EvRuAfW5vwUFdo2ix4oaYvHdxpSt2zndb
transaction
3cdb30203670b91d111d66a752a43aa771c50dfe976fed1d035af07728f76416
spent
true